Form 4: Civista Bancshares Director Weaks Nathan E Reports Stock Award and Disposals

Sentiment:

SEC Form 4 Filing


Director Weaks Nathan E reports acquisition of 1,027 shares and disposal of 3,339 shares of Civista Bancshares common stock on May 12, 2025.

Summary

  • On May 12, 2025, Nathan E Weaks, a director of a subsidiary of Civista Bancshares, Inc., reported a transaction involving the company's common stock.
  • Weaks acquired 1,027 shares through a stock award from the Civista Bancshares, Inc. 2024 Incentive Plan.
  • Weaks also disposed of 3,339 shares of common stock.
  • Following these transactions, Weaks directly owns 3,339 shares of Civista Bancshares common stock.
  • Weaks also indirectly owns 6,283 shares through an IRA.

Industry Context

Form 4 filings are a routine part of regulatory compliance for publicly traded companies and their insiders. They provide transparency into the transactions of company insiders, allowing investors to monitor potential alignment of interests between management and shareholders.
